Formulário de processo de bot em Central de APR

  • Versão de lançamento: Yokohama
  • Atualizado 30 de jan. de 2025
  • 12 min. de leitura
  • Use o formulário Processo de bot para associá-lo à configuração do processo de bot e preencha os campos restantes necessários para um processo de bot.

    Tabela 1. Formulário de processo de bot
    Campo Descrição
    Processo de bot
    Nome Nome exclusivo do processo de bot.
    Tipo do processo Tipo de processo de bot:
    • Autônomo: automações que não exigem intervenção humana.
    • Assistido: automações que exigem intervenção humana.
    Configuração de processo de bot [Gerado automaticamente] Configuração do processo de bot associado do processo de bot.
    Ordem Ordem de prioridade de execução para o processo de bot.
    • 1: prioridade mais alta
    • 999999: prioridade mais baixa

    Se mais de um processo de bot autônomo estiver programado para iniciar ao mesmo tempo, aquele com a prioridade mais alta será executado e os outros serão marcados como Ignorados.

    Se vários processos de bot tiverem a mesma prioridade e programação, um processo de bot será escolhido aleatoriamente para ser executado.Para obter mais informações, consulte Prioridade de execução de processos de bot em Central de APR.

    O valor padrão é definido como 1.

    O usuário comercial de RPA pode exibir este campo.

    Este campo aparece somente quando Autônomo é selecionado no campo Tipo de processo.

    Pacote Pacote associado do processo de bot.

    Para um processo de bot autônomo, associe um pacote do tipo autônomo.

    Para um processo de bot assistido, associe um pacote do tipo assistido.

    Somente pacotes publicados podem ser associados.

    Versão do Pacote Versão do pacote ativo em uso.

    Somente versões de pacote publicadas podem ser associadas.

    Status da fase do ciclo de vida [Gerado automaticamente] Status da fase do ciclo de vida da configuração do processo de bot.
    Limite de tempo de execução (minutos) Duração esperada para o processo de bot ser executado.

    O valor padrão é 60 minutos.

    Este campo aparece somente quando Autônomo é selecionado no campo Tipo de processo.

    O usuário comercial de RPA pode exibir este campo.

    Este campo é obrigatório.

    Limpeza de trabalho (dias) Número de dias após o qual os dados do trabalho são excluídos.
    Gerenciado por Proprietário de TI do processo de negócios.

    Este campo aparece somente para um registro existente.

    Funções necessárias para editar este campo: gerente de versão de RPA e administrador de RPA.

    Pertencente a Usuário comercial que faz parte do gerenciado por um grupo e é responsável pelo processo de negócios.

    Este campo aparece somente para um registro existente.

    Este campo depende do que você inseriu no campo Gerenciado por grupo.

    Se uma entrada no campo Gerenciado por grupo estiver preenchida, somente os usuários que fazem parte do campo Gerenciado por grupo e têm uma função de usuário comercial de RPA podem ser adicionados ao campo Pertencente a.

    Se o campo Gerenciado pelo grupo estiver vazio, o campo Pertencente a será somente leitura.

    Funções necessárias para editar este campo: gerente de versão de RPA e administrador de RPA.

    Ativar automação de tarefa integrada Opção para acionar o processo de bot assistido (automação) a partir do formulário ServiceNow associado que está mapeado no registro de configuração assistido. Para obter mais informações sobre o registro de configuração assistida, consulte Formulário Configuração assistida no Central de APR.

    Ao habilitar a caixa de seleção Automação de tarefa integrada, duas guias adicionais, Parâmetros de campo de processo e Configuração assistida, são exibidas no formulário de processo de bot.

    Para obter mais informações sobre a Automação de tarefa integrada, consulte Automação de tarefa integrada no Central de APR.

    Descrição Descrição do processo de bot.
    Configurações de sessões
    Manter o monitor ativo Opção para manter o monitor ativo da máquina em que o robô está executando o processo de bot.

    Este campo aparece somente quando Autônomo é selecionado no campo Tipo de processo.

    Restauração de sessão automática Opção para restaurar o estado do robô para a fase inicial antes que a automação seja executada.

    Este campo aparece somente quando Autônomo é selecionado no campo Tipo de processo.

    Forçar início

    Opção para forçar o início de um processo de bot em um robô para substituir qualquer outro processo de bot já em execução nele.

    Se a opção Forçar início estiver habilitada para um processo de bot P1 e se o processo de bot P2 estiver em execução no mesmo robô, o P2 será interrompido e o P1 será executado. Em seguida, o trabalho de processo de P2 passa para o estado Cancelado.

    A opção Forçar início não substitui o campo Ordem. A opção Forçar início é aplicável aos processos de bot em execução existentes e não é aplicável aos processos de bot que ainda não foram iniciados.

    Este campo aparece somente quando Autônomo é selecionado no campo Tipo de processo.

    Habilitar Desktop em Desktop Opção para habilitar a automação assistida para ser executada na janela Desktop na área de trabalho. Esta opção cria uma nova sessão na mesma máquina e a automação pode ser executada nesta sessão sem interromper o trabalho manual real na sessão principal.

    Ao habilitar esta opção, a caixa de seleção Finalizar desktop na área de trabalho ao concluir também é marcada.

    Este campo aparece somente quando Assistido é selecionado no campo Tipo de processo.

    Encerrar desktop em desktop ao concluir

    Opção para fechar a janela Desktop in Desktop após a conclusão da execução do processo de bot.

    Esta opção é selecionada automaticamente quando você seleciona Habilitar área de trabalho na área de trabalho. Para deixar a janela Desktop na área de trabalho aberta após a conclusão do processo de bot, desmarque a caixa de seleção.

    Este campo aparece somente quando Assistido é selecionado no campo Tipo de processo.

    Resolução da tela Resolução de tela da área de trabalho na janela Desktop.

    Este campo aparece somente quando Assistido é selecionado no campo Tipo de processo.

    Configurações de Log
    Acompanhar logs de execução Opção para habilitar o acompanhamento de logs de execução de processo.

    Depois de marcar esta caixa de seleção, os logs são capturados quando uma automação é executada por um robô assistido ou autônomo. Esses logs ajudam a entender os erros e o registro em log de ponta a ponta da execução da automação.

    Se os trabalhos de processo forem limpos, os logs de execução correspondentes serão limpos.

    Ao usar o recurso Anexar em Design studio de RPA para desktop, esses logs de execução podem ser usados para reproduzir novamente a automação para entender onde a automação falhou. Por exemplo, em qual componente a automação falhou ou detalhes das entradas passadas para esse componente.
    Nota:
    O recurso Anexar não é compatível com o tipo de saída de arquivo simples.
    Sincronizar logs de execução (segundos) Frequência, em segundos, para a sincronização dos logs de execução.

    Este campo aparece somente quando a opção Rastrear logs de execução está selecionada.

    Se você selecionar Máquina do robô no campo Armazenamento, este campo ficará oculto.

    Armazenamento
    Nota:
    Este campo aparece somente quando a opção Rastrear logs de execução está selecionada.
    Opções de local de armazenamento para os logs de execução:
    • Instância: somente informações de erro são registradas no log de execução na instância.

      Se você selecionar Instância, o valor do campo Nível de log será definido como Erro e não poderá ser editado.

    • Máquina do robô: os arquivos de log são armazenados na máquina do robô em que a automação é executada.

      Se você selecionar Máquina do robô, poderá exibir duas opções para selecionar no campo Nível de log - Erro ou Detalhamento.

      Para exibir os logs de execução de ponta a ponta de todos os componentes, selecione Máquina do robô no campo Armazenamento e selecione Detalhamento no campo Nível de log.

      Para uma utilização ideal do espaço em disco na máquina do robô, os logs existentes são limpos, com base na configuração de propriedade do sistema sn_rpa_fdn.purge_client_logs.

    Se você selecionar Máquina robótica,
    • O campoSincronizar logs de execução está oculto.
    • Os logs de execução são armazenados na máquina na qual o robô assistido ou autônomo está instalado.
    Tipo de Saída Tipo de saída do arquivo de log de execução. Este arquivo de log é gerado durante a execução do robô na máquina. Existem dois tipos de saída:
    • Arquivo do banco de dados: valor padrão. É um arquivo de banco de dados simples que armazena os metadados do trabalho do processo e os detalhes da execução da automação de processos. Após a conclusão do trabalho do processo, você pode anexar o arquivo de banco de dados usando a opção Anexar no projeto Design studio de RPA para desktop para reproduzir a automação na superfície de design.
    • Arquivo simples: é um formato de arquivo que armazena os metadados do trabalho do processo e os detalhes da execução da automação de processos em texto simples. Ele armazena os dados de execução em um formato JSON.

    Este campo Tipo de saída aparece quando a opção Rastrear logs de execução é selecionada e quando a máquina do robô é selecionada no campo Armazenamento.

    Se um processo de bot, com Arquivo simples como o tipo de saída, for acionado, o arquivo de log de execução será adicionado à pasta de trabalho do processo no formato .txt nos locais fornecidos. Da mesma forma, para o tipo de saída DB, você exibirá o formato .db nos locais fornecidos.

    O local dos arquivos simples e dos arquivos de banco de dados está na máquina na qual o robô assistido ou autônomo está instalado.
    • Durante a execução: Usuários\<Userprofile> \Logs de RPA da ServiceNow\.executionlogs\{InstanceName}\{ProcessJob number} .

      Por exemplo, Usuários\john.smith\ServiceNow RPA Logs\.executionlogs\{InstanceName}\PJB0001165.

    • Após a conclusão da execução: Usuários\<Userprofile> \ServiceNow RPA Logs\.executionlogs\{InstanceName}\.archive\{ProcessJob number} .

      Por exemplo: Usuários\john.smith\ServiceNow RPA Logs\.executionlogs\{InstanceName}\.archive\PJB0001165.

    O conteúdo dos arquivos simples está no formato JSON. A imagem a seguir fornece a estrutura de conteúdo.

    Quando você escolhe a opção Arquivo simples para armazenar os logs de execução, dois arquivos simples são gerados e armazenados nos locais fornecidos.
    • ExecutionJobMetadata.txt: contém informações sobre o trabalho do processo, como o ID do processo, o ID do robô e o nível do log. A imagem mostra a estrutura do conteúdo no arquivo.
      Figura 1. Estrutura de conteúdo em arquivo simples
      Metadados de execução.
    • Nome do arquivo no formato ddMMYyyy HHmmss.txt (por exemplo, 28Dec2023 125036.txt): contém as entradas do log de execução. Por exemplo, o arquivo fornece o nome da Atividade, a hora de início e término da execução do componente, a duração e o resultado em booliano, se aplicável.

    Os arquivos simples seguem as regras de limpeza de dados definidas na propriedade do sistema sn_rpa_fdn.purge_client_logs. Para obter mais informações sobre a propriedade do sistema, consulte Configurar propriedades do Central de APR.

    Importante:
    Em Design studio de RPA para desktop, se você marcar uma ou mais portas de entrada ou de saída de um ou mais componentes ou métodos em uma automação como Marcar dados como confidenciais, o arquivo simples não registrará em log os dados de execução do trabalho de processo correspondente. Em vez disso, no arquivo JSON, os dados correspondentes à porta aparecem como SENSÍVEL. A imagem a seguir fornece um exemplo.
    Figura 2. Porta indicada como confidencial
    Porta indicada como confidencial.
    Para obter mais informações sobre como marcar uma porta de entrada ou de saída como Marcar dados como confidenciais, consulte Configurar propriedades da porta

    Como os dados reais dos logs de execução contêm muitos dados, somente os dados necessários são preservados. O conteúdo no arquivo de texto é do tipo JSON.

    Para modificar o valor deste campo para um processo de bot existente, certifique-se de que o processo de bot associado esteja no estado Em manutenção.

    Nível de Log Selecione um nível de log para capturar:
    • Erro-

      Somente informações de erro são armazenadas durante a execução da automação.

    • Detalhamento-

      Informações de erro e logs de execução de componente de ponta a ponta, como entradas e saídas e etapas de execução com carimbos de data/hora, são armazenados durante a execução da automação. Quando você seleciona Detalhado, os arquivos simples registram detalhes da execução de todos os componentes na automação. Se o tamanho do arquivo simples exceder 10 MB enquanto o trabalho do processo é executado, o arquivo simples continuará a ser dividido em vários arquivos simples com a sequência de log anexada na convenção de nomenclatura de arquivo até que ele execute a automação completa. As convenções de nomenclatura desses arquivos são<timestamp> _<LogSequence> .

      Esta opção aparece somente quando a máquina Robô é selecionada como tipo de armazenamento.

    Este campo aparece somente quando a opção Rastrear logs de execução está selecionada.

    Rastrear logs de automação Rastreie os logs de automação que são gerados pelo robô. O robô registra a execução da automação em logs de automação. Os logs ajudam os usuários de RPA a rastrear o andamento da automação.

    Para obter mais informações sobre como exibir os logs de automação, consulte Exibir logs de automação em Central de APR.

    Para exibir logs de automação de um processo de bot, em Design studio de RPA para desktop, use o componente Log na automação associada e preencha os detalhes necessários.

    Para obter mais informações sobre o componente Log, consulte Usar o componente de log.

    Access
    Gerenciado pelo grupo Grupo que pode acessar o processo de bot.
    Pool de robôs

    Funções necessárias para editar este campo: gerente de versão de RPA e administrador de RPA.

    Se um desenvolvedor de RPA e um usuário de suporte de RPA fizerem parte de Gerenciado pelo grupo, eles poderão exibir e editar esses campos.

    O usuário comercial de RPA pode exibir esses campos.

    Ativar pool de robôs Opção para habilitar o pool de robôs para o processo de bot.

    Ao habilitar esta opção, a guia Atribuir robôs no processo de bot fica oculta.

    Para obter mais informações sobre o pool de robôs, consulte Pool de robôs em Central de APR.

    Pool de robôs Robôs que você pode alocar dinamicamente de um pool de robôs selecionado.

    Selecione um pool de robôs em uma lista de nomes de pool de robôs existentes.

    Este campo aparece somente quando a opção Habilitar pool de robôs está selecionada.

    Tipo de alocação Robôs que você pode alocar com base no Acordo de nível de serviço (ANS) dos itens de trabalho ou na porcentagem de ganho de eficiência.
    Selecione o tipo de alocação:
    • Baseado em ANS: alocação de robôs do pool com base no ANS do item de trabalho. Os itens de trabalho são classificados e priorizados com base no ANS.

      Se você selecionar o tipo de alocação como Baseado em ANS, certifique-se de que os itens de trabalho contenham um Acordo de nível de serviço (ANS).

    • Redução de porcentagem: alocação de robôs do grupo com base na porcentagem de eficiência.

    O valor padrão é Baseado em ANS.

    Este campo aparece somente quando a opção Habilitar pool de robôs está selecionada.

    Percentagem de redução Este campo aparece somente quando a Redução de percentual é selecionada no campo Tipo de alocação.

    Reduza o tempo total de execução de um processo de bot alocando mais robôs em uma porcentagem selecionada.

    Por exemplo, se houver 100 itens de trabalho atribuídos a um processo de bot. Pode levar 100 minutos para executar o processo de bot. Se você quiser reduzir esse tempo para 75 minutos, defina um valor 25 neste campo.

    Depois de fornecer um valor neste campo, vários robôs são alocados para distribuir a carga de trabalho. Portanto, a automação é executada mais rapidamente nessa porcentagem.

    O valor padrão é 25.

    Os robôs são alocados para distribuir a carga de trabalho, com base na porcentagem selecionada:
    • Se você selecionar um valor de 5 a 50, 2 robôs serão alocados.
    • Se você selecionar 55, 60 ou 65, 3 robôs serão alocados.
    • Se você selecionar 70 ou 75, 4 robôs serão alocados.
    • Se você selecionar 80, 6 robôs serão alocados.
    • Se você selecionar 85, 7 robôs serão alocados.
    Escrever
    Anotações de trabalho (privado) Anotações de trabalho para o processo de bot.

    Exiba as mudanças executadas no pacote associado, versão do pacote, parâmetro de processo, parâmetro compartilhado, fila e programação.

    Comentários adicionais Comentários adicionais relacionados ao processo de bot.